Customer portal
Definition
A customer portal is an online platform where customers have access to various services and information that a company offers. It is designed to improve and simplify communication between a company and its customers.
Benefits of a customer portal
- Links with other systems: A good customer portal integrates with various systems such as CRM, ERP, and accounting software. This ensures that customers have access to all relevant information in one place.
- Self-service tools: Customers can manage their own data, view invoices, and request support without customer service intervention.
- 24/7 Access: Customers can access the portal at any time of the day, increasing flexibility and usability.
- Safety and Privacy: A customer portal must meet strict security standards to protect customer data.
- User-friendly Interface: An intuitive and easy-to-navigate interface is essential for a positive user experience.
Features of a B2B customer portal
- Real-time Data: Customers have access to current inventory and pricing information, increasing trust and efficiency.
- Self-service: Customers can place, track, and manage orders themselves, reducing the need for phone, fax, or email communication.
- Integration with ERP systems: This ensures that all data is consistent and reliable, without employees having to manually update.
- Account Management: Customers can update their business information, contacts, and payment information.
- Support: Access to a knowledge base, frequently asked questions (FAQs), and the ability to submit support tickets and track their status.
